Trump Official Exposed: Lutnick’s Lies About Epstein Revealed
UPDATE: New documents have exposed significant discrepancies in statements made by former Trump Commerce Secretary Howard Lutnick regarding his ties to Jeffrey Epstein. This shocking revelation has prompted urgent calls for accountability from Rep. Robert Garcia (D-CA), the top Democrat on the House Oversight Committee.
Just days ago, the Department of Justice released approximately 3.5 million files related to Epstein, revealing that Lutnick’s claim of having no interactions with Epstein post-2005 is fundamentally false. In a statement, Garcia emphasized, “We have some serious questions,” underscoring the gravity of these findings.
In an October 2022 interview with the New York Post, Lutnick stated that he and his wife had visited Epstein’s New York residence in 2005 and then cut ties. However, the newly uncovered documents indicate Lutnick was actively arranging a visit to Epstein’s private island as late as 2012, with plans involving his wife and children. Furthermore, CBS News reports that Lutnick and Epstein were engaged in business dealings tied to a now-defunct advertising technology company called Adfin until at least 2014.
Emails released by the DOJ show that Lutnick and Epstein maintained contact beyond 2005, with correspondence about arranging meetings and social engagements as late as 2011. Notably, in 2017, Epstein pledged a donation of $50,000 to a dinner event honoring Lutnick, and Lutnick reached out to Epstein in 2018 regarding real estate matters.
In response to the revelations, a Commerce Department spokesperson criticized the media for what they described as an attempt to distract from the administration’s achievements, stating that Lutnick has “never been accused of wrongdoing.”
